Open XML "tunat"

Ecma a raspuns ieri la inca o serie de comentarii depuse de membri ISO asupra standardului Open XML. Cineva a lucrat si de sarbatori…, fiindca 3252 din cele 3522 de comentarii au deja rezolvare.
Membri ISO au acces la toate raspunsurile. As aminti aici doar cateva dintre raspunsuri, care sunt publice deja:

  • Utilizarea formatului ISO-8601 pentru reprezentarea datelor (permite reprezentarea datelor mai „mici” de anul 1900 si evitarea vestitului bug de an bisect fals pentru 1900)
  • Utilizarea BCP 47 de la IETF pentru taguri de limba
  • Permiterea de margini de documente custom
  • Utilizarea Extended BNF de la ISO pentru gramatica (simplifica testarea si validarea pentru implementatori)
  • Documentarea completa a setarilor de compatibilitate (cum este vestitul „AutoSpaceLikeWord95” si inca cateva astfel de setari, care sunt de fapt buguri din respectivele aplicatii vechi si conformitatea cu acestea necesita cateva linii de cod suplimentare)
  • Extragerea din standard a tuturor elementelor legacy si includerea lor intr-o anexa, pentru a fi depreciate/eliminate in versiunile urmatoare (e vorba de VML, setarile de compatibilitate de mai sus, conformitatea cu bug-ul de an fals bisect pentru 1900 samd; recomandarea este ca aceasta anexa sa nu se foloseasca pentru generarea de documente noi)
  • Clarificarea clauzelor de conformitate (inclusiv includerea conformitatii semantice pe langa cea de sintaxa)
  • Reorganizarea standardului in 3 parti: prima va fi specificatia de markup in sine, a doua va fi specificatia de packaging (OPC), iar a treia va fi specificatia pentru extensibilitate
  • Utilizarea standardului ISO/IEC 10118-3 pentru hash-uri de parole.

Personal am acces la raspunsuri si marturisesc ca acum sunt mult, mult mai increzator, si sunt convins ca standardul asta va fi aprobat de membri ISO.
De ce?
Fiindca Ecma face ceea ce trebuie!

Filed under: Open XML